Abstract

The whole education system is focusing its attention on measures to improve Academic Achievement of learners and techniques of emulating Personality Traits of students to shape their Personality. The present study explains the association between personality and academic achievement on the basis of previous studies done by various researchers. It showed that personality is correlated with academic achievement and personality scores also indicated academic achievement which we find in scores.
